  3. 3
    Incidents·HYDROPAC 1719/132013-06-14 09:41Z → cancelled 2013-07-06 04:11Z
    Australia to new zealand
    Tasman Sea · Tasman Sea
    TASMAN SEA.
    AUSTRALIA TO NEW ZEALAND.
    60 FOOT S/V NINA, WHITE AND GREEN HULL, SEVEN PERSONS
    ON BOARD, UNREPORTED NEWCASTLE (32-55S 151-45E)
    TO OPUA (35-19S 174-07E). LAST KNOWN POSITION VICINITY
    33-54S 165-18E ON 04 JUN. VESSELS IN VICINITY
    REQUESTED TO KEEP A SHARP LOOKOUT, ASSIST IF POSSIBLE.
    REPORTS TO MARITIME OPERATIONS NEW ZEALAND,
    INMARSAT-C: 451200067, PHONE: 644 914 8333
    OR TAUPO MARITIME RADIO.
